This print showcases the exquisite painting "Portrait of Germain Soufflot (1713-1780) architect of the Pantheon" by Louis Michel van Loo. The artwork, dating back to the 18th century, measures 0.79x0.62 meters and is currently housed in the Musee et Domaine National de Versailles et de Trianon in Versailles, France. In this striking portrait, Van Loo masterfully captures the essence of Germain Soufflot, a renowned French architect responsible for designing the iconic Pantheon.
